Özet
Exact solutions of the Schrödinger equation for two different potentials are presented by using the extended Nikiforov-Uvarov method. The first one is the inverse square root potential which is a long-range potential and the second one is a combination of Coulomb, linear, and harmonic potentials which is often used to describe quarkonium. Eigenstate solutions are obtained in a systematic way without using any ansatz or transformation. Eigenfunctions for considered potentials are given in terms of biconfluent Heun polynomials.
